A ROBBERY victim was kicked in the head by a group of people in the early hours of Sunday (September 9).
At around 3.15am, a man in his 40s was walking down an alleyway from Wentworth Road towards the town centre when he was assaulted by a group of people, believed to be male and female.
He was kicked several times, causing bruising and swelling to his head, face and body which required hospital treatment.
The muggers stole a wallet containing cash from the victim.
Detective Constable Katherine Brock at Rugby Police Station said: “An investigation has been launched and a number of enquiries are currently ongoing.
“We are appealing to anyone who witnessed the offence or any suspicious behaviour in the area to please come forward.”
